The Demand for Teachers in 2024

The teaching profession is facing a significant challenge in 2024: a growing teacher shortage. This shortage is not a new phenomenon, but it is becoming increasingly acute in various regions around the world. This shortage has far-reaching implications for the quality of education and the future of our students.

Teacher Shortage in Various Regions

The teacher shortage is a global issue, but its severity varies across different regions. In the United States, for example, there is a projected shortage of over 100,000 teachers by 2025. Similarly, in the United Kingdom, there is a growing concern about the number of qualified teachers available to fill vacant positions.

Factors Contributing to the Teacher Shortage

  • Low Salaries:The teaching profession often struggles to attract and retain qualified candidates due to relatively low salaries compared to other professions requiring similar levels of education and training.
  • High Workload:Teachers are often burdened with heavy workloads, including classroom instruction, lesson planning, grading, and administrative tasks. This can lead to burnout and stress, making the profession less appealing.
  • Lack of Support:Teachers may face a lack of support from administrators, policymakers, and the community, which can impact their morale and job satisfaction.

Impact of Teacher Shortage on Education

The teacher shortage has a direct impact on the quality of education. When there are not enough qualified teachers to fill all positions, schools may be forced to hire unqualified individuals or leave positions vacant. This can lead to larger class sizes, reduced instructional time, and a decline in the quality of teaching and learning.

The shortage can also lead to a widening gap in educational outcomes, particularly for students from disadvantaged backgrounds.

Types of Teaching Degrees in 2024

To become a teacher, individuals typically need to obtain a teaching degree. There are various types of teaching degrees available, each with its own unique curriculum and career path.

Bachelor’s Degrees in Education

A Bachelor of Education (BEd) is a four-year undergraduate degree program designed to prepare individuals for a career in teaching. BEd programs typically cover a broad range of subjects, including educational psychology, curriculum development, teaching methods, and classroom management.

  • Specializations:BEd programs may offer specializations in specific subject areas, such as elementary education, secondary education, special education, or early childhood education.
  • Curriculum:BEd programs typically include coursework in educational theory, research methods, and practical teaching experiences. Students will also have the opportunity to complete student teaching placements in schools.

Master’s Degrees in Education

A Master of Education (MEd) is a graduate degree program that provides advanced training for teachers. MEd programs are designed to enhance teachers’ knowledge, skills, and leadership abilities.

  • Specializations:MEd programs offer a wide range of specializations, including curriculum and instruction, educational leadership, special education, and educational technology.
  • Curriculum:MEd programs typically include coursework in educational research, policy analysis, and advanced teaching methods. Some programs may also offer opportunities for research and professional development.

Doctorate Degrees in Education

A Doctor of Education (EdD) is a terminal degree in education that prepares individuals for leadership roles in education. EdD programs are research-intensive and typically focus on educational policy, administration, and innovation.

  • Specializations:EdD programs may offer specializations in areas such as educational leadership, curriculum development, and educational technology.
  • Curriculum:EdD programs typically include coursework in educational theory, research methods, and dissertation writing. Students will also be required to conduct original research and publish their findings.

Choosing the Right Teaching Degree

Selecting the right teaching degree program is a crucial decision. There are several factors to consider when making this choice.

Factors to Consider

  • Career Goals:What are your long-term career aspirations? Do you want to teach at the elementary, secondary, or post-secondary level? Do you want to pursue a leadership role in education?
  • Desired Subject Area:What subject are you passionate about teaching? Are you interested in teaching a specific age group or student population?
  • Location:Where do you want to teach? Some teaching degree programs may be more focused on specific geographic regions or school districts.

Researching and Comparing Programs

Once you have identified your career goals and preferences, it is important to research and compare different teaching degree programs. Consider the following factors:

  • Accreditation:Ensure that the program is accredited by a recognized body, such as the National Council for Accreditation of Teacher Education (NCATE) in the United States.
  • Faculty:Review the faculty profiles and research interests of the professors teaching in the program.
  • Course Offerings:Examine the curriculum and course offerings to see if they align with your interests and career goals.

Importance of Internships and Student Teaching

Internships and student teaching experiences are essential for aspiring teachers. These experiences provide valuable hands-on training and allow students to apply their knowledge and skills in real-world settings. Internships and student teaching can also help students develop important professional skills, such as classroom management, communication, and collaboration.

The Future of Teaching in 2024

The education landscape is constantly evolving, and teachers need to be adaptable and innovative to meet the needs of today’s students. Emerging trends in education are shaping the skills and knowledge required of teachers in the future.

Emerging Trends in Education, Teaching Degree 2024

  • Technology Integration:Technology is playing an increasingly important role in education. Teachers need to be proficient in using technology to enhance learning and create engaging classroom experiences.
  • Personalized Learning:Personalized learning approaches are becoming more prevalent. Teachers need to be able to differentiate instruction and tailor their teaching to meet the individual needs of their students.
  • Social-Emotional Learning:Social-emotional learning (SEL) is becoming increasingly recognized as a critical component of education. Teachers need to be able to support students’ social and emotional development.

Impact of Trends on Teacher Skills

These emerging trends are impacting the skills and knowledge required of teachers in the future. Teachers will need to be adaptable, innovative, and technologically proficient. They will also need to be able to differentiate instruction, foster student engagement, and support students’ social and emotional development.

Resources and Support for Teachers

Teachers have access to a wide range of resources and support to help them succeed in their careers. These resources can provide professional development opportunities, mentorship, and advocacy.

Organizations and Resources

  • Professional Development Programs:Many organizations offer professional development programs for teachers, covering topics such as new teaching methods, technology integration, and classroom management.
  • Mentorship Networks:Mentorship networks connect experienced teachers with new teachers to provide guidance and support.
  • Advocacy Groups:Advocacy groups work to promote the interests of teachers and advocate for better working conditions and resources.

Importance of Ongoing Professional Development

Ongoing professional development is essential for teachers throughout their careers. It allows teachers to stay up-to-date on the latest research and best practices in education, enhance their teaching skills, and address emerging challenges in the classroom.

Online Resources and Websites

There are numerous online resources and websites where teachers can find support, information, and inspiration. Some popular resources include:

  • National Education Association (NEA):The NEA is the largest labor union representing teachers in the United States.
  • American Federation of Teachers (AFT):The AFT is another major labor union representing teachers in the United States.
  • Edutopia:Edutopia is a website that provides resources and articles on educational best practices.
  • Teachers Pay Teachers:Teachers Pay Teachers is a marketplace where teachers can buy and sell educational resources.

Answers to Common Questions

What are the typical requirements for a teaching degree program?

Requirements vary depending on the program and institution. Generally, a bachelor’s degree is required, and some programs may require specific coursework in education or a related field. Admissions criteria often include standardized test scores, such as the GRE or Praxis exams, as well as letters of recommendation and personal statements.

What are the job prospects for teachers with a degree in 2024?

The job market for teachers is expected to remain competitive in 2024. However, with a strong teaching degree and relevant experience, graduates can find positions in public and private schools, as well as other educational settings. It is essential to stay informed about current trends and develop skills that align with the evolving needs of the education system.

What are the average salaries for teachers with a degree in 2024?

Teacher salaries vary depending on location, experience, and educational qualifications. It is recommended to research salary ranges for specific positions and regions of interest. Salary information is often available on websites such as Indeed, Glassdoor, and Salary.com.
